Spiro Raises $100M, the Largest Investment in Africa’s E-Mobility Sector


Funding: $100 million
Goal: Expand electric vehicle infrastructure across Africa
Impact: Reducing emissions while creating thousands of green jobs across the continent

CFM’s Climate Investor Two Fund Closes at $1.07B, the Largest Adaptation Fund in Emerging Markets

Funding: $1.07 billion
Goal: Finance infrastructure and climate adaptation projects in developing economies
Impact: Strengthening resilience across regions most affected by climate change
